About this book
In a rapidly changing society marked by shifting fortunes and class struggles, "The Guarded Heights" by Wadsworth Camp explores the complexities of social identity and ambition. George Morton, a young man facing the harsh realities of his declining status, finds himself captivated by Sylvia Planter, the daughter of affluence. As he navigates the treacherous waters of love and societal expectations, themes of aspiration and personal integrity emerge.
